The Secret Knitting is done and has been turned in.  This is the only thing I can show you until it's released later in the year.  I can tell you that the yarn, Stacatto from Shibui, was absolutely fabulous to knit with!  And this isn't the actual color; the one I got the joy of knitting with hasn't been released yet.  :)


I gave up on the warp that was on the loom and cut the whole mess off.  I did invest in the Floor Loom Weaving class on Craftsy, which has taught me more in a few hours than what I gleaned from library books and websites.  If you haven't heard of Craftsy, go over there and try one one the free classes.  I'm liking their format more and more; it has the convenience of a CD to rewind and replay, but the addition of being able to email questions to the instructor is the best thing since sliced bread!  I plan on using my little Secret Knitting check to pick up a warping board, couple of shuttles, and other things I need to start weaving.  Lord knows I have enough yarn to start with!
